Minor surgeries are less invasive, often performed under local anesthesia, and usually allow same-day discharge. They are typically outpatient procedures with minimal recovery time.
Major surgeries involve more complex procedures, often under general anesthesia, and may require a hospital stay. These are indicated for conditions that cannot be treated conservatively.
